Mea Culpa'd

Crusades, blood libels, inquisitions and conversions that were forced,
indifference to the blood of helpless Jews spilt in the holocaust,
a litany of crimes for which the Pope should use his bully pulpit,
and yet equivocates while in denial, hardly mea culpa’d,
will be forgotten soon, because the mantra never to forget
itself will be forgotten and the crimes of Nazi will be set
aside, diminished in importance by great other acts of genocide
and claims they never happened to six million, and the Jews just lied.

Pope John Paul II has expressed condemnation regarding the acts of the Church against the Jews but has failed to admit that the responsibility was not that of individual Catholics but of the Church. Furthermore, he maintains an eerie silence about the passive role that the Church as a whole, as Pope Pius XII in particular (whom he wishes to canonize) played during the Holocaust.

I wrote the first quatrain on 3/14/00 and the second on 2/10/-0, compiling my poems on the Shoah.
